North Muskegon, MI: when does the frost end?
Typically, the last spring freeze lands around 04/30, roughly 245 days out. Fall's first freeze usually shows up around 10/19, roughly 170 days after the last spring frost.
North Muskegon sits in USDA Zone 6b (-5 to 0°F average annual minimum). The dates above are NOAA's 1991-2020 normal at the nearest reporting station, a 30-year average, not a forecast.

Why 04/30 isn't a guarantee
04/30 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Getting tender plants in by 04/17 carries real risk, frost has hit that late in about 9 of 10 years here. Wait until 05/18 and only about 1 year in 10 sees frost after that.
